Introduction to Becoming an RTO in Australia

Forming a Registered Training Organisation (RTO) in AU demands thorough compliance and adherence with the rules of the Australian Skills Quality Authority (ASQA). This resource seeks to explain the process to support newcomers comprehend how to register as an RTO, get through the RTO registration process, and guarantee conformance with the Australian Skills Quality Authority (ASQA).

Essential Steps to Become an RTO

1. Learning the RTO Registration Requirements
Before starting the process to become an RTO, it's important to familiarise yourself with the ASQA requirements. These involve:
- ASQA Standards 2015: For quality training and assessment.
- Australian Qualifications Framework (AQF): Essential compliance for all RTOs.
- Financial Viability Risk Assessment Requirements: To guarantee financial viability.
- Requirements for Data Reporting: To ensure accurate data reporting to ASQA.

2. Creating a Self-Assessment
It is required by ASQA a self-review to confirm your RTO meets all standards. This involves:
- Examining your training and assessment strategies.
- Confirming the qualifications of trainers and assessors.
- Showing your ability to provide quality training and support services.

3. Building a Detailed Business Plan
Your business plan should describe:
- Distinct Selling Proposition: The unique aspects of your RTO.
- Budget Projections: Detailing start-up costs, ongoing expenses, and revenue streams.
- Risk Evaluation: Finding potential risks and mitigation strategies.
- Framework of the Organisation: Roles and duties of key personnel.
- Objectives and Milestones: Short-term and long-term goals.

4. Setting Up Infrastructure
The right infrastructure is essential for RTO success. Make sure:
- Adequate training facilities.
- Crucial policies and procedures.
- Sufficient student support services.
- Robust management systems.

5. Financial Management and Viability
Starting an RTO necessitates an initial investment including:
- Company formation fees.
- Application fees to ASQA.
- Spending for infrastructure, consultants, and learning resources.
- Ongoing running costs including inspections, updating and enhancing educational materials, and staff training.

The chief income source for an Registered Training Organisation comes from training fees. Comprehensive budget planning and viability evaluations are imperative.

6. Navigating Application and Audit
The application and inspection process is your initial step to starting an RTO. It entails:
- Lodging the initial application by the ASQA online portal.
- Going through an inspection by ASQA to check compliance with requirements for RTOs.
- Receiving a RTO registration certificate that is valid for two years upon successful fulfilment.

7. Legal and Regulatory Considerations
RTOs must conform to related territory rules and regulatory standards. Sustained compliance with the VET Compliance Framework is essential, and the audit and review process by ASQA is recurrent, necessitating regular reviews of the entity's conformity with rules.
